Application of Japan Functional Acids Market

The Japan Functional Acids Market finds extensive application across various industries, including electronics, pharmaceuticals, cosmetics, and food processing. In electronics, these acids are crucial for etching and cleaning semiconductor components, ensuring high precision and performance. The pharmaceutical industry utilizes functional acids in drug formulation and synthesis, enhancing bioavailability and stability. In cosmetics, they are used to adjust pH levels, exfoliate skin, and improve product efficacy. Additionally, functional acids play a vital role in food processing, acting as preservatives, flavor enhancers, and pH regulators. Their versatile properties make them indispensable in manufacturing processes, contributing to product quality and safety. Japan Functional Acids Market By Type Segment Analysis

The Japan Functional Acids market is classified into several key types, primarily including organic acids (such as citric, acetic, and lactic acids), inorganic acids (notably phosphoric, sulfuric, and hydrochloric acids), and specialty acids tailored for specific industrial applications. Organic acids dominate the market due to their extensive use in food, beverage, and pharmaceutical sectors, driven by rising health consciousness and clean-label product trends. Inorganic acids, while historically foundational, are witnessing a gradual shift towards specialty formulations that meet stringent environmental and safety standards. The market size for organic acids in Japan is estimated to be approximately USD 1.2 billion in 2023, accounting for around 55% of the total functional acids market, with inorganic acids contributing roughly USD 1 billion, or 45%. Over the next five years, the organic acids segment is projected to grow at a CAGR of approximately 4.5%, driven by demand for natural preservatives and flavoring agents. Inorganic acids are expected to grow at a slower pace of around 2.5%, as industries seek more sustainable and eco-friendly solutions. The fastest-growing segment within the functional acids market is the specialty organic acids, particularly those used in high-tech applications such as electronics cleaning, cosmetics, and biodegradable plastics. This segment is still emerging but exhibits a high growth potential, with an estimated CAGR of 6-7% over the next decade. The growth is fueled by technological innovations that enable more efficient production processes and the development of novel acid formulations. The market is currently in a growth stage characterized by increasing R&D investments and expanding application scopes. Key growth accelerators include rising consumer demand for natural and sustainable products, regulatory pressures favoring environmentally friendly chemicals, and advancements in biotechnology that facilitate bio-based acid production. Innovation in delivery systems and formulation techniques is further enhancing the efficacy and safety profiles of functional acids, supporting their broader adoption across industries.
